Hi hackers,
during reading the source code of new incremental backup functionality
I noticed that the following condition can by unintentional:
/*
* For newer server versions, likewise create pg_wal/summaries
*/
if (PQserverVersion(conn) < MINIMUM_VERSION_FOR_WAL_SUMMARIES)
{
...
if (pg_mkdir_p(summarydir, pg_dir_create_mode) != 0 &&
errno != EEXIST)
pg_fatal("could not create directory \"%s\": %m", summarydir);
}
This is from src/bin/pg_basebackup/pg_basebackup.c.
Is the condition correct? Shouldn't it be ">=". Otherwise the function
will create "/summaries" only for older PostgreSQL versions.
I've attached a patch to fix it in case this is a typo.

You seem right, nice catch. Also, this change makes the check in
snprintf(summarydir, sizeof(summarydir), "%s/%s/summaries",
basedir,
PQserverVersion(conn) < MINIMUM_VERSION_FOR_PG_WAL ?
"pg_xlog" : "pg_wal");
redundant. PQserverVersion(conn) will always be higher than
MINIMUM_VERSION_FOR_PG_WAL.
